Match Facts & Stats

  • Juventus have won 10 of their last 12 matches
  • Juventus have scored at least 2 goals in 10 of their last 12 matches
  • AC Milan have failed to score in each of their last two home games
  • The last time they went three consecutive games at San Siro without scoring in the competition was in December 2007
  • Milan have won just two of their last ten meetings with Juventus in Serie A

Preview

Milan come into this game having finally ended a downward spiral by defeating Chievo 4-1 on the road. Prior to that, the Rossoneri were sans a win in their last four matches, and disturbingly, this included a 2-0 loss to Sampdoria and a scoreless draw with Genoa - two teams that considering the amount of money the club's owners spent this summer that they should have defeated.

Unfortunately for the hosts, they're missing Leonardo Bonucci due to suspension, whilst Giacomo Bonaventura could miss out due to injury, making their task of stopping the visiting reigning Serie A champs more difficult.

Meanwhile, Juventus are still in third spot and will be hoping to chase down the top two sides, Inter and Napoli by beating Milan in today's big game. The Bianconeri saw their long-standing unbeaten home record snapped by Lazio last weekend, but come into this game having won their last two games by an aggregate score of 10 to 3 by crushing Udinese 6-2 and SPAL 4-1. With Mario Mandzukic back from a ban, they now have more options in attack, whilst Massimiliano Allegri is expected to bring back Giorgio Chiellini and Gigi Buffon back into the starting XI after resting both midweek.
